1/* 2 * linux/drivers/ide/arm/rapide.c 3 * 4 * Copyright (c) 1996-2002 Russell King. 5 */ 6 7#include <linux/module.h> 8#include <linux/slab.h> 9#include <linux/blkdev.h> 10#include <linux/errno.h> 11#include <linux/ide.h> 12#include <linux/init.h> 13 14#include <asm/ecard.h> 15 16/* 17 * Something like this really should be in generic code, but isn't. 18 */ 19static ide_hwif_t * 20rapide_locate_hwif(void __iomem *base, void __iomem *ctrl, unsigned int sz, int irq) 21{ 22 unsigned long port = (unsigned long)base; 23 ide_hwif_t *hwif; 24 int index, i; 25 26 for (index = 0; index < MAX_HWIFS; ++index) { 27 hwif = ide_hwifs + index; 28 if (hwif->io_ports[IDE_DATA_OFFSET] == port) 29 goto found; 30 } 31 32 for (index = 0; index < MAX_HWIFS; ++index) { 33 hwif = ide_hwifs + index; 34 if (hwif->io_ports[IDE_DATA_OFFSET] == 0) 35 goto found; 36 } 37 38 return NULL; 39 40 found: 41 for (i = IDE_DATA_OFFSET; i <= IDE_STATUS_OFFSET; i++) { 42 hwif->hw.io_ports[i] = port; 43 hwif->io_ports[i] = port; 44 port += sz; 45 } 46 hwif->hw.io_ports[IDE_CONTROL_OFFSET] = (unsigned long)ctrl; 47 hwif->io_ports[IDE_CONTROL_OFFSET] = (unsigned long)ctrl; 48 hwif->hw.irq = hwif->irq = irq; 49 hwif->mmio = 1; 50 default_hwif_mmiops(hwif); 51 52 return hwif; 53} 54 55static int __devinit 56rapide_probe(struct expansion_card *ec, const struct ecard_id *id) 57{ 58 ide_hwif_t *hwif; 59 void __iomem *base; 60 int ret; 61 62 ret = ecard_request_resources(ec); 63 if (ret) 64 goto out; 65 66 base = ecardm_iomap(ec, ECARD_RES_MEMC, 0, 0); 67 if (!base) { 68 ret = -ENOMEM; 69 goto release; 70 } 71 72 hwif = rapide_locate_hwif(base, base + 0x818, 1 << 6, ec->irq); 73 if (hwif) { 74 hwif->hwif_data = base; 75 hwif->gendev.parent = &ec->dev; 76 hwif->noprobe = 0; 77 probe_hwif_init(hwif); 78 ide_proc_register_port(hwif); 79 ecard_set_drvdata(ec, hwif); 80 goto out; 81 } 82 83 release: 84 ecard_release_resources(ec); 85 out: 86 return ret; 87} 88 89static void __devexit rapide_remove(struct expansion_card *ec) 90{ 91 ide_hwif_t *hwif = ecard_get_drvdata(ec); 92 93 ecard_set_drvdata(ec, NULL); 94 95 /* there must be a better way */ 96 ide_unregister(hwif - ide_hwifs); 97 ecard_release_resources(ec); 98} 99 100static struct ecard_id rapide_ids[] = { 101 { MANU_YELLOWSTONE, PROD_YELLOWSTONE_RAPIDE32 }, 102 { 0xffff, 0xffff } 103}; 104 105static struct ecard_driver rapide_driver = { 106 .probe = rapide_probe, 107 .remove = __devexit_p(rapide_remove), 108 .id_table = rapide_ids, 109 .drv = { 110 .name = "rapide", 111 }, 112}; 113 114static int __init rapide_init(void) 115{ 116 return ecard_register_driver(&rapide_driver); 117} 118 119MODULE_LICENSE("GPL"); 120MODULE_DESCRIPTION("Yellowstone RAPIDE driver"); 121 122module_init(rapide_init);
